The high-res models all agree with Environ Canada for the Sun-Sun night Winter Storm: An average of 12β/30cms of fluffy snow across the GTA/ #Toronto, w/ peaks of 14-15β/40cms where lake effect snow bands persist most. Away from lake enhancement, 6-10β/15-25cms for rest of SE Ontario #ONstorm #ONwx

Toronto friends: on Wed nite-Thurs the official forecast from Environ Canada is flurries/2cms of snow. But some computer models now predict a snowstorm as temps plummet & snow/liquid ratios skyrocket. Look @ this insane spread just 24hrs out: 4 models forecasting from 0.8β/2cms to 18.9β/48cmsπ΅βπ« #ONwx
